>>>> The traditional Xen way of loading a kernel and initial data structures
>>>> into the
>>>> guest's memory is by calling libxc functions. We want to be able to run
>>>> without
>>>> libxc dependencies though, so we need an alternative.
>>>>
>>>> This patch implements a full domain builder for xenner. It loads the guest
>>>> kernel, sets up basic memory layouts and saves everything off for the pv
>>>> communication device between xenner and qemu.
